Palmitoyl dipeptide-7 is a signal-like peptide that promotes matrix proteins, promotes collagen synthesis, and may also increase the production of elastin, hyaluronic acid, glycosaminoglycan and fibronectin. It promotes collagen synthesis by increasing stromal cell activity, making the skin look more elastic and youthful.
Palmitoyl Dipeptide-7 is one of the shortest peptides. When tested with human skin equivalents, it was found to enhance differentiation of the epidermis, basement membrane zone,and dermal fibroblasts. Within dermal fibroblasts, Palmitoyl Dipeptide-7 increased collagen I, collagen IV,and fibronectin. Use of peptides for topical application is limited by the ionic nature of the amino acid chains.However, this may be circumvented through the incorporation of a lipophilic derivative, such as palmitoyl.
